Output 261075763ce1c8350617523f4e56c04b425886c1ec5da0301b378951ea82a40a:1

value
943911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e40748b405d9802c32530b19dc468f62bdfe96 OP_EQUAL
address
3DtxxkZaaCks6mzqfHe3U5BCxjawdwgrtX
transaction
261075763ce1c8350617523f4e56c04b425886c1ec5da0301b378951ea82a40a
confirmations
280521
spent
true